Foundation crack repair services address issues where existing cracks in a building’s foundation may compromise structural integrity or allow moisture intrusion. These repairs typically involve assessing the severity and type of cracks, such as vertical, horizontal, or diagonal, and then implementing appropriate solutions like ep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or wall stabilization. Projects can range from small hairline cracks to larger, more significant fractures that require extensive intervention to prevent further damage and maintain the stability of the property.
Property owners often seek foundation crack repair to prevent issues like uneven settling, basement leaks, or worsening structural problems. Before requesting service, it is helpful to understand the location, size, and pattern of cracks, as well as any accompanying signs of foundation movement or water intrusion. Proper evaluation of these factors ensures the selected repair method effectively addresses the specific conditions of the property, helping to safeguard its long-term stability and value.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ious issues? Not all cracks indicate structural problems; some are minor and do not affect stability.
How are foundation cracks rep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ks and reinforcing the foundation to prevent further movement.
When should property owners consider repair services? Repairs are recommended when cracks are wide, growing, or accompanied by other signs of foundation movement.
